Quote:
Originally Posted by MisterCamaro69 View Post
BIW... What more do you want?

...For GM to put it together for ya?
Because building a BIW from the ground up is cost and time prohibitive for someone who just wants to race showroom stock, AS, or pro-level autocross, and classes like that. Not everyone who goes racing has a full race shop to build a car like that.... a LOT goes into building a BIW....

And a 1LE car can be used on the street as well...
